Làm thế nào để bạn lặp lại 5 lần trong python?
Trong lập trình, có những bộ hướng dẫn bạn sẽ cần lặp lại nhiều lần. Ví dụ: nếu bạn muốn thực hiện cùng một tác vụ trên mọi mục trong danh sách. Điều gì sẽ xảy ra nếu bạn có một danh sách các chiến dịch và muốn in từng chiến dịch? Show Khi bạn cần lặp lại một tập hợp các hướng dẫn, đôi khi bạn biết trước số lần lặp lại; . Cũng có những lúc số lần lặp lại không quan trọng và bạn muốn lặp lại mã cho đến khi đáp ứng một điều kiện nhất định Đối với tất cả các mục đích này, bạn sử dụng các vòng lặp. Vòng lặp for x in range(5): print(x)4Vòng lặp 4 là loại vòng lặp cốt lõi trong Python. Một vòng lặp 4 được sử dụng để lặp qua bất kỳ trình tự nào. Đó có thể là một danh sách, bộ dữ liệu, từ điển hoặc thậm chí là một chuỗi. Với vòng lặp 4 , bạn có thể thực thi cùng một mã cho từng phần tử trong chuỗi đó. Python giúp dễ dàng lặp qua mọi phần tử của chuỗi. Nếu bạn muốn in mọi phần tử trong danh sách, nó sẽ như thế này
Trong mã này, mỗi phần tử trong 0 sẽ được in ra thiết bị đầu cuối. 1 là tên biến cập nhật thành phần tử tiếp theo mỗi khi vòng lặp lặp lại. Về mặt lý thuyết, bạn có thể thay đổi 1 thành 3 và nó vẫn thực hiện chức năng tương tự. Hoạt động của vòng lặp for. Bạn có thể thực hiện cùng một loại vòng lặp 4 nếu muốn lặp qua mọi ký tự trong một chuỗiĐể lặp qua một bộ mã một số lần nhất định, bạn có thể sử dụng hàm 5 trả về danh sách các số bắt đầu từ 0 đến số kết thúc được chỉ địnhBạn chưa tìm hiểu về các chức năng, nhưng bạn sẽ sớm. Hiện tại, bạn chỉ cần biết rằng bạn có thể nhập một số vào hàm 5 và hàm này sẽ trả về một danh sách các số từ 0 đến số đó - 1.
Mã này sẽ in tuần tự 0, 1, 2, 3, 4 ________số 8Dấu ngoặc nhọn 7 ở đây sẽ lấy bất kỳ giá trị nào trong biến 8 và đặt nó vào vị trí của nó. Vì vậy, trong ví dụ này, mã sẽ in 1Hàm 5 mặc định là giá trị bắt đầu bằng 0, nhưng bạn có thể thay đổi hàm này bằng cách thêm một số nguyên khác như vậy. 0Phạm vi này sẽ trả về các giá trị từ 4 đến 10 (nhưng không bao gồm 10) Vòng lặp for x in range(100): print(f"{x} bottles of beer on the wall!")1Trong khi vòng lặp 4 cho phép bạn thực thi mã với một số lần nhất định, thì vòng lặp 1 sẽ tiếp tục thực thi cho đến khi một điều kiện nhất định được đáp ứng. Trong chương trước, bạn đã tìm hiểu về các điều kiện dưới dạng câu lệnh đánh giá đúng hoặc sai. Điều tương tự cũng áp dụng ở đây. mã trong câu lệnh 1 sẽ tiếp tục thực thi cho đến khi điều kiện trở thành saiĐoạn mã bên dưới kiểm tra dung lượng hiện tại và tăng dung lượng lên 1 cho đến khi đạt dung lượng tối đa ( 5 tăng giá trị hiện tại lên 1) 8Vì 6 bắt đầu từ 3 nên mã này thực thi 7 lần cho đến khi 6 chạm 10. Hoạt động của vòng lặp while. Điều quan trọng là phải nhận thức được các vòng lặp vô hạn. Nếu điều kiện bạn đặt luôn đúng, vòng lặp sẽ tiếp tục chạy mãi mãi Ví dụ 1Trong tình huống này, x sẽ không bao giờ đạt 5 Lên cấp. Loop-the-LoopCung cấp cho chương trình của bạn một số déjà vu. Thực hành sử dụng vòng lặp 4 và 1 và tìm hiểu thêm một số thủ thuật khi bạn thực hành. 🙂 🙃 🙂 🙃https. //api. tiếp theo. tech/api/v1/publishable_key/2A9CAA3419124E3E8C3F5AFCE5306292?content_id=16b92b9c-8411-4d63-a459-3b546e4ae9e0 Hãy tóm tắt lại
Vòng lặp rất tốt để giúp bạn lặp lại mã dễ dàng. Tiếp theo, chúng ta sẽ đi sâu vào các chức năng;
1 2 Tạo Ồ Chúng tôi rất vui khi thấy rằng bạn thích các khóa học của chúng tôi (đã xem 5 trang hôm nay). Bạn có thể tiếp tục xem các khóa học của chúng tôi bằng cách trở thành thành viên của cộng đồng OpenClassrooms. Nó miễn phí Bạn cũng sẽ có thể theo dõi tiến độ khóa học của mình, thực hành các bài tập và trò chuyện với các thành viên khác Đăng ký Đăng nhập 1 2 Tạo Chỉ thành viên Premium mới có thể tải xuống video từ các khóa học của chúng tôi. Tuy nhiên, bạn có thể xem chúng trực tuyến miễn phí Lấy tiền thưởng 1 2 Tạo Chỉ thành viên Premium mới có thể tải xuống video từ các khóa học của chúng tôi. Tuy nhiên, bạn có thể xem chúng trực tuyến miễn phí Lấy tiền thưởng Quản lý logic chương trình trong Python
Giáo viên Sẽ Alexander Nhà phát triển, giáo viên và nhạc sĩ người Scotland có trụ sở tại Paris Raye Schiller Raye Schiller là một kỹ sư phần mềm phụ trợ có trụ sở tại Thành phố New York và có bằng MEng. về Khoa học Máy tính của Đại học Cornell 🙏💻 |